Chapter 3

Author: Perfect Timing
A familiar voice came from behind me.

"Nevaeh, I never thought you could be this cruel."

I turned. Wesley was striding toward me, his face full of anger.

Right behind him was Lily, her head lowered, her expression shy and soft.

My pupils tightened as I watched the two of them approach.

Wesley looked regretful as he spoke to the crowd.

"The real killer is my wife. Yesterday was supposed to be our wedding anniversary.

"I begged her to stay home, but she insisted on going out."

He shook his head helplessly. "She killed someone. I share the blame.

"If I hadn't let her leave, none of this would have happened."

His performance worked. The crowd instantly leaned toward him.

"Nevaeh, I just finished giving my statement," he said, looking at me. "You should confess."

I let out an icy laugh. My sharp gaze shifted past him and landed on Lily.

"I didn't kill anyone. Why would I confess?

"The real murderer is Lily. What does this have to do with me?

"Last night, I was on a business trip..."

"You're lying!" A sharp female voice cut me off. Lily glared at me, anger flashing in her eyes.

Everyone turned to look at her.

"Nevaeh, you're lying!

"Yesterday, I saw you getting cozy with another man. When I caught you, you didn't even feel ashamed!

"And now, in front of the police and the victims' family, you're trying to frame me?"

She pulled out her phone and held it up.

There was a photo on the screen. A picture of me kissing a man.

"You all see this, right? I'm not lying!

"I have proof!"

I could not help but sneer. If she could fake dashcam footage, forging a photo like that would be nothing.

The crowd stirred again.

"Unbelievable. Not only is she vicious, but she's shameless, too."

"She has a husband and still cheats? That's disgusting."

Then, my husband joined them. His face was full of pain as he leaned weakly against Lily's shoulder.

"Nevaeh, I never thought you could do something like this.

"You cheated on me. Do you even have a conscience?"

Then he grabbed the officer's hand tightly. "Officer, you have to stand up for me!

"The reason Nevaeh stole the baby is that she can't have children!"

My heart skipped. I looked at Wesley, a mocking glint in my eyes.

Under the crowd's questioning stares, he hesitated for a moment, then continued.

"When we got married, I already knew Nevaeh couldn't get pregnant because of a medical condition."

As soon as he finished speaking, a wave of murmurs spread through the crowd.

"Man, you knew she couldn't have kids and still married her? That's dedication."

"Officer, isn't that a motive? You already have evidence. Arrest her now!"

Even though I had lived through this once before, facing it again still made panic rise in my chest.

"I have witnesses and evidence that prove I didn't commit the murder!"

My voice rang out, loud and firm. The noisy crowd fell silent. Even the officers frowned as they looked at me.

"We've already checked your flight records," one of them said. "They show you went to Avalon City early yesterday morning.

"The crime happened at nine last night.

"How do you plan to rule out your involvement?"
